2008-2009 Pepperdine University
Seaver College Student Computer Recommendations

To take full advantage of the technology resources available at Pepperdine University, students are encouraged to own a laptop that meets at least the minimum specifications in the following table. If you already own a computer and do not wish to purchase a new one at this time, you should ensure that it meets these minimum specifications. Students who do not own a computer that meets these specifications should upgrade or purchase a new laptop that meets the recommended specifications as listed below. The following academic programs have additional recommendations or requirements to the ones listed above.

Academic Program

Recommendations or Requirements

Business Administration Division
Seaver College

BA Majors are required to own a laptop that meets at least the minimums listed above, along with Microsoft Office 2003 Professional. Apple computers do not qualify.

Natural Sciences Division
Seaver College

Students considering a degree for any Natural Science division program will be served equally well by an Apple or Windows laptop.  Windows recommended specs: see above.  Apple recommended specs: any MacBook Pro with 2GB RAM, 120GB hard drive, and SuperDrive.  Apple minimum specs: any MacBook with 1GB RAM, 120GB hard drive, and SuperDrive.  Students wishing to use Boot Camp or Parallels with Windows Vista: 256MB video RAM is recommended.
